As you'll have gathered, no-one knows the answer but my theory is that it wasn't the only one but all the others were wood and rotted away.
If you look at the lintels you'll see they each have 2 different classic carpentry joints in 4 different positions, AND they're curved. Ideal for a small wooden structure with tight joints but a bit mad for huge and very hard stones. Also, a pointless design because unlike in wood there was no way the joints could be made tight fitting or have dowels inserted. It looks like a show-off piece rather than a well-designed one.
